What Affects Local Move Cost in Wilmington?

Home Size

Studio: $400-$800. 1-2 bedroom: $600-$1,500. 3-4 bedroom: $1,000-$2,500

Hourly Rate

2 movers + truck: $100-$180/hour. 3 movers: $150-$250/hour

Tips to Save on Local Move in Wilmington

  • 1.Move mid-month and mid-week for the lowest rates
  • 2.Pack everything yourself
  • 3.Declutter before the move to reduce load size
  • 4.Get at least 3 in-home estimates

Frequently Asked Questions

How long does a local move take?

Studio/1BR: 2-4 hours. 2-3 BR: 4-7 hours. 4+ BR: 6-10 hours.
